Comparing Game Speed and Payout Potential

Not all live games are created equal when you are in a hurry. The following comparison table highlights differences in typical round duration and the nature of potential wins in common live dealer offerings. Remember that individual casino implementations may vary, so always check the table rules before buying in.

Game Type Average Round Length Payout Speed Potential Best For Quick Wins?
Live Blackjack 30–60 seconds Variable; depends on side bets Yes, if you use side wagers
Live Roulette 45–90 seconds High on single-number bets Yes, for high-risk players
Live Baccarat 20–40 seconds Moderate; even bets win quickly Yes, very fast rounds
Live Poker (e.g., Casino Hold’em) 60–120 seconds Medium; bonus bets add speed Sometimes

As you can see, live baccarat offers the fastest rounds—sometimes under half a minute—which means more opportunities to hit a win within a short session. Blackjack with side bets can also accelerate payouts, but you must be disciplined about not chasing losses. Roulette remains the quintessential game for all-or-nothing speed if you place straight-up bets, though the odds are steeper.

Common Misconceptions About Live Dealer Speed

Many players assume that all live games move slowly because of the human element. In reality, the fastest live studios are optimized for speed: dealers are trained to keep the pace, cameras cut quickly between views, and software automates payouts instantly. The bottleneck is almost always the player’s own hesitation. If you know the rules cold and have your bets ready, you can complete dozens of rounds in an hour. That is ample opportunity for a quick payout.

Another misconception is that you must bet maximum amounts to win fast. While larger bets produce larger wins, they also increase your risk. A smarter approach for speed is to use flat betting at a level you are comfortable with, combined with occasional side bets when the feeling is right. This balances the chance for a sudden big win with the sustainability to keep playing.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. Can I really win real money quickly with live dealers?
Yes, but “quickly” is relative. Live dealer games process real money bets in real time; a win can be credited to your account within seconds of the round ending. Withdrawal speed depends on the casino’s banking policies.

2. Are live dealer games fair?
Reputable live studios use multiple camera angles and are monitored by regulators. You can see every action, and the equipment is tested. However, always play at licensed casinos to ensure fairness.

3. What is the fastest live dealer game?
Typically, live baccarat has the shortest rounds—often 20 to 40 seconds. Speed roulette variants also exist where the wheel is spun immediately after bets close.

4. Do I need a special strategy for live games compared to RNG games?
For blackjack and poker, basic strategy applies the same. For roulette and baccarat, no strategy changes the odds, but bankroll discipline is more important in live settings due to the faster pace.
